About the role
The Accounts Officer will support the day-to-day finance operations of K-Drill, ensuring supplier invoices, customer invoices, reconciliations and debtor follow-up are handled accurately and on time.
You will work closely with finance, operations and management in a practical business environment where urgency, ownership and high standards matter.
Key responsibilities
* Processing supplier invoices, purchase orders and payment runs
* Reconciling supplier statements and resolving invoice queries
* Preparing and issuing customer invoices
* Monitoring accounts receivable and following up overdue accounts
* Managing credit control processes and maintaining clear debtor notes
* Allocating customer payments and reconciling accounts
* Assisting with bank and credit card reconciliations
* Maintaining accurate supplier and customer records
* Supporting payroll, BAS preparation and month-end reporting as required
* Liaising with suppliers, customers and internal teams professionally
* Providing general finance and administration support to the business
* Looking for ways to improve processes, accuracy and turnaround times
